개발블로그

  • 홈
  • 태그
  • 방명록

Predicate 1

동작 파라미터화 코드 전달하기(1)

앞으로 모던 자바 인 액션 책을 읽고 기억해야 할 내용이나 새로 알게 된 내용을 정리해보려 한다. 아래는 2장 동작 파라미터화 코드 전달하기의 일부 내용이다. 우리가 어떤 상황에서 일을 하던 소비자의 요구사항은 항상 바뀐다. 시시각각 변하는 사용자 요구사항에 어떻게 대응해야 할까? → 동작 파라미터화를 이용하자! 동작 파라미터화란? : 아직은 어떻게 실행할 것인지 결정하지 않은 코드블록을 의미한다. 첫번째 시도 : 기존의 농장 재고목록 애플리케이션에 리스트에서 녹색 사과만 필터링 하는 기능을 추가해 보자! public static List filterGreenApples(List inventory){ List result = new ArrayList(); for (Apple apple : inventor..

JAVA 2023.01.10
이전
1
다음
더보기
프로필사진

개발블로그

개발자 박응디 cjdrud123@naver.com

  • 분류 전체보기 (126)
    • JAVA (81)
    • Python & Django (6)
    • Server(설정 등) (5)
    • DB (2)
    • Git (4)
    • Swift (7)
    • React (6)
    • AWS (2)
    • CT (5)
    • 참고사항 (8)

Tag

swift, 개발, 설정, JPA, query, Spring, TDD, APP, entity, mapping, code, java, IP, python, IOS, DB, test, React, 개발자, testcode,

Calendar

«   2025/05   »
일 월 화 수 목 금 토
1 2 3
4 5 6 7 8 9 10
11 12 13 14 15 16 17
18 19 20 21 22 23 24
25 26 27 28 29 30 31

Copyright © Kakao Corp. All rights reserved.

티스토리툴바